In this Showdown, you really don't compete against another player; so it's not PVP anymore.
I recalled in the first season of this game, when you challenge another player, you will play the 1st and 3rd quarter while your opponent will play the second and fourth. The game was not a live game because each take turns only, yet each playing by skill.
In the new Showdown matches, you're actually playing vs the app itself. What's the point of building a team to get a higher rank and get defeated by lower ranks, in my recent case...and the other team didn't even play?
